Millennium Park and Cloud Gate

Your first stop is the Millennium Park Welcome Center, where you’ll get an overview of the city’s recent cultural boom. The highlight here is the Cloud Gate, affectionately called “the Bean.” This sleek, reflective sculpture is a magnet for photos—something you’ve probably seen in countless travel posts. The 20-minute photo stop allows you to capture that perfect shot, plus soak in the lively atmosphere around the park.

Grant Park and Chicago Water Tower

Next, you’ll pass by Grant Park, a sprawling green space right in the heart of downtown. It’s a favorite for locals and visitors alike, often hosting events and festivals. The Chicago Water Tower, a historic Gothic Revival building, is another quick photo stop, notable for its resilience after the Great Chicago Fire of 1871.

Lakeside Landmarks

The tour then glides past Navy Pier, a beloved Chicago landmark known for its Ferris wheel, eateries, and entertainment, though it’s a passing view rather than a stop. You’ll also see Buckingham Fountain, famous for its impressive water displays, and the distinctive Marina City towers, with their eye-catching design.

The Skyscraper Corridor

As you cruise along, you’ll pass notable skyscrapers like Trump Tower and the Willis Tower. The guide’s commentary will add context, sharing stories about these architectural giants that define Chicago’s skyline. While skipping the interior, these views alone are worth the ride, especially if you’re into cityscapes.

Optional Upgrades: Art and Observation

At this point, you can choose to explore further. The Art Institute of Chicago, the second-largest art museum in the United States, is a renowned cultural stop—entry costs $32 for adults, with discounts available. Many reviewers mention that it’s a must-see if you’re into art or just want a break from outdoor sightseeing.

Alternatively, the 360 Chicago Observation Deck offers sweeping views from the 94th floor of the John Hancock Center. For $35, you’ll see the city from above, with some reviews mentioning that the view is breathtaking and worth the upgrade.
